Responsibilities:

As an Export Case Maker/Packer, you will play a pivotal role in our production process.

Your duties will include:

- Assembling wooden panels / wooden bases using pneumatic nail guns.

- Using hand tools to pre-assemble components.

- Operating cross cut saws, bandsaws, ripsaws and various woodworking machinery.

- Packing of various sized material from 1 kg to 70,000 kg.

- Using overhead cranes to aid in the manufacture and packing process

- Be prepared for physical work, including standing for extended periods and repeated lifting of materials.
